Types of Women's Sweaters:
-
Crew Neck Sweaters:
A classic style with a round neckline, the crew neck sweater is versatile and can be dressed up or down.
-
V-Neck Sweaters:
Featuring a V-shaped neckline, these sweaters are often worn over collared shirts and can help elongate the neck.
-
Turtleneck Sweaters:
With a high collar that folds over, turtleneck sweaters provide extra warmth and a sophisticated appearance.
-
Cable Knit Sweaters:
Recognizable by their textured, interwoven knit patterns, cable knit sweaters add depth and visual appeal.
-
Sweater Dresses:
Sweater Dresses are long enough to be worn as a dress, providing a stylish and cozy alternative.
-
Cardigans:
Open-front sweaters that can be buttoned or zipped, cardigans are ideal for layering and come in various lengths and styles.
-
Pullover Sweaters:
Any sweater that is pulled over the head is considered a pullover. This is a general term that includes crew neck and V-neck sweaters.
-
Off-the-Shoulder Sweaters:
Designed to be worn with exposed shoulders, these sweaters offer a fashionable and slightly more revealing look.

Choosing the Best Materials for Women's Sweaters:
The material significantly impacts a sweater's warmth, feel, and maintenance. Here are some common choices:
-
Wool:

Cotton:
Breathable and comfortable, cotton sweaters are suitable for milder weather and are generally easier to care for than wool.
-
Cashmere:
A luxurious fiber, cashmere is incredibly soft, lightweight, and warm. Cashmere sweaters are typically more expensive and considered a high-quality investment.
-
Synthetic Fibers:
Fibers like acrylic and polyester are often blended with natural fibers to enhance durability, reduce cost, or simplify care.

Styling Tips for Women's Sweaters:
-
Layering:
Sweaters are excellent for layering. For a classic look, wear a V-neck sweater over a collared shirt, or layer a cardigan over a тонкий turtleneck for extra warmth.
-
Dressing Up:
Elevate a sweater by pairing it with a skirt, dress pants, and heels. Add statement jewelry to complete the outfit.
-
Dressing Down:
For a casual style, wear a sweater with jeans and sneakers or ankle boots.
-
Accessorizing:
Personalize your sweater look with accessories like a scarf, hat, or statement necklace.
